Cybersecurity Engineer (Governance)



Job description

Develops and delivers user training and awareness programs to promote cybersecurity best practices across the organization.


Assist in the implementation and management of Governance, Risk, and Compliance (GRC) frameworks.


Conducts regular security awareness campaigns and training sessions for employees.


Monitors and reports on compliance with cybersecurity policies, standards, and regulations.


Supports the development and maintenance of cybersecurity policies, procedures, and guidelines.


Collaborates with various departments to ensure alignment with cybersecurity governance objectives.


Performs risk assessments and assist in the development of risk mitigation strategies.


Stays updated on the latest cybersecurity trends, threats, and regulatory requirements.


Job Requirements
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, Cybersecurity, or a relevant field.


Minimum 2 years’ of experience as a Cybersecurity Analyst or in a similar role, running user training and awareness campaigns.


Relevant certifications (e.g., CompTIA Security+, CISSP) are a plus.


Familiarity with Cybersecurity Governance, Risk, and Compliance (GRC) concepts and frameworks.


Strong understanding of cybersecurity principles and best practices.


Excellent communication and presentation skills with ability to work collaboratively with cross-functional teams.


Location and Working Hours
Location: 50 Gul Road, Singapore (Islandwide transport provided).


Working Hours: Monday – Thursday: 8:00am – 5.15pm, Friday: 8:00am – 4.30pm.
